Esempio n. 1
0
        public bool GuardarTabuladores(TabuladorViewModel tabulador)
        {
            var dto = ObtenerDTOTabuladores(tabulador);

            try
            {
                var resultado = repositorioRepository.GuardarTabuladores(dto);

                if (resultado != null)
                {
                    return(resultado.Value > 0 ? true : false);
                }
                else
                {
                    return(false);
                }
            }
            catch (System.Exception ex)
            {
                throw ex;
            }
        }
Esempio n. 2
0
        public bool GuardarDatoOperacion(TabuladorViewModel tabulador)
        {
            var dto = ObtenerDTOTabuladores(tabulador);

            try
            {
                var resultado = actualizaCteRepo.GuardarDatoOperacion(dto);

                if (resultado != null)
                {
                    return(resultado.Value > 0 ? true : false);
                }
                else
                {
                    return(false);
                }
            }
            catch (System.Exception ex)
            {
                throw ex;
            }
        }
Esempio n. 3
0
        private TabuladorDTO ObtenerDTOTabuladores(TabuladorViewModel tabulador)
        {
            var dto = new TabuladorDTO();

            dto.InformacionContacto = ObtenerDTOContactosTabuladores(tabulador.InformacionContacto);
            dto.TarifaServicio      = ObtenerDTOTarifasTabuladores(tabulador.TarifaServicio);
            dto.TabuladorDinamico   = ObtenerDTOTabuladorDinamicoTabuladores(tabulador.TabuladorDinamico);

            dto.IdPrecliente       = tabulador.IdPrecliente;
            dto.IdUsuario          = tabulador.IdUsuario;
            dto.EjecutivoVenta     = tabulador.EjecutivoVenta;
            dto.EquipoOperativo    = tabulador.EquipoOperativo.IdEquipo.ToString();
            dto.TipoCliente        = tabulador.TipoCliente;
            dto.RFC                = tabulador.RFC;
            dto.NombreCliente      = tabulador.NombreCliente;
            dto.ClientePedimento   = tabulador.ClientePedimento;
            dto.SitioFTP           = tabulador.SitioFTP;
            dto.DireccionPaginaWeb = tabulador.DireccionPaginaWeb;
            dto.Usuario            = tabulador.Usuario;
            dto.Contrasena         = tabulador.Contrasena;
            dto.EntregaFisica      = tabulador.EntregaFisica;
            dto.DiasRevision       = tabulador.DiasRevision;
            dto.HorarioRevision    = tabulador.HorarioRevision;
            dto.PersonasReciben    = tabulador.PersonasReciben;
            dto.NumJuegoCopia      = tabulador.NumJuegoCopia;
            dto.CalleNumero        = tabulador.CalleNumero;
            dto.Colonia            = tabulador.Colonia;

            /*
             * dto.Estado.ID = tabulador.Estado.id;
             * dto.Estado.Descripcion = tabulador.Estado.Descripcion;
             * dto.Ciudad.ID = tabulador.Ciudad.id;
             * dto.Ciudad.Descripcion = tabulador.Ciudad.Descripcion;
             */
            if (tabulador.Estado != null)
            {
                dto.Estado = tabulador.Estado.id;
            }
            else
            {
                dto.Estado = "0";
            }
            if (tabulador.Ciudad != null)
            {
                dto.Ciudad = tabulador.Ciudad.id;
            }
            else
            {
                dto.Ciudad = "0";
            }
            dto.CP = tabulador.CP;
            dto.ComprobadosCtePed          = tabulador.ComprobadosCtePed;
            dto.ComprobadosCeteFact        = tabulador.ComprobadosCeteFact;
            dto.ComprobadosEmpresaFactura  = tabulador.ComprobadosEmpresaFactura;
            dto.CtaAmericanaCtePed         = tabulador.CtaAmericanaCtePed;
            dto.CtaAmericanaCeteFact       = tabulador.CtaAmericanaCeteFact;
            dto.CtaAmericanaEmpresaFactura = tabulador.CtaAmericanaEmpresaFactura;
            dto.HonorariosCtePed           = tabulador.HonorariosCtePed;
            dto.HonorariosCeteFact         = tabulador.HonorariosCeteFact;
            dto.HonorariosEmpresaFactura   = tabulador.HonorariosEmpresaFactura;
            dto.ImpuestosCtePed            = tabulador.ImpuestosCtePed;
            dto.ImpuestosCeteFact          = tabulador.ImpuestosCeteFact;
            dto.ImpuestosEmpresaFactura    = tabulador.ImpuestosEmpresaFactura;
            dto.CtaAMEFactura   = tabulador.CtaAMEFactura;
            dto.CtaAMEExpedida  = tabulador.CtaAMEExpedida;
            dto.CtaAMECobra     = tabulador.CtaAMECobra;
            dto.CtaAMEExpedidor = tabulador.CtaAMEExpedidor;
            dto.ImpuestoPeca    = tabulador.ImpuestoPeca;

            dto.Banco   = tabulador.Banco;
            dto.BancoId = tabulador.BancoId;

            dto.DatoAdicional    = tabulador.DatoAdicional;
            dto.MetodoPago       = tabulador.MetodoPago;
            dto.UltimosDigitos   = tabulador.UltimosDigitos;
            dto.Intrucciones     = tabulador.Intrucciones;
            dto.CondicionPago    = tabulador.CondicionPago;
            dto.PeriodoGracia    = tabulador.PeriodoGracia;
            dto.DiasPago         = tabulador.DiasPago;
            dto.HorarioPago      = tabulador.HorarioPago;
            dto.SuspenderCliente = tabulador.SuspenderCliente;
            dto.Fondo            = tabulador.Fondo;
            dto.MontoFondo       = tabulador.MontoFondo;
            dto.Financiamiento   = tabulador.Financiamiento;
            dto.Monto            = tabulador.Monto;
            dto.ParaUso          = tabulador.ParaUso;
            dto.PuntoReorden     = tabulador.PuntoReorden;
            dto.Recuperacion     = tabulador.Recuperacion;
            dto.Plazo            = tabulador.Plazo;
            dto.Condicion        = tabulador.Condicion;
            dto.EstimadoVenta    = tabulador.EstimadoVenta;

            return(dto);
        }